Libyan forces battling Islamic State in Sirte suffer losses in push to advance
Forces aligned with Libya’s U.N.-backed government suffered losses from snipers and mines on Friday as they battled Islamic State to win control of a strategic conference center in the coastal city of Sirte. Islamic State is clinging on in the center of Sirte in the face of a two-month campaign by brigades mainly composed of […]







